The Site Engineer is responsible for the day-to-day technical operations on a construction site, ensuring that construction work is carried out according to plans, specifications, and safety standards. The role includes supervising contractors, solving on-site issues, conducting inspections, and ensuring materials and workmanship meet project requirements. The Site Engineer acts as a key link between the design team and on-site execution, helping keep the project on track and aligned with technical expectations.
